Fort wall collapse kills seven of a family in Madhya Pradesh’s Datia



Rescue operations are underway in the Khalka Pura area of Datia, Madhya Pradesh after a wall collapsed due to heavy rainfall, resulting in the tragic deaths of seven people and injuring two others. The incident occurred at the historic Rajgarh Fort when a portion of the wall collapsed on two houses early in the morning. Local authorities, including the SDERF and police, responded to the scene to rescue the trapped individuals. The challenging rescue operation was hindered by narrow lanes and old structures in the area. The Chief Minister has expressed condolences and announced financial assistance for the affected families. The State government is taking steps to assess and demolish at-risk buildings to prevent future tragedies.
